New Delhi, April 8
The Supreme Court on Wednesday directed the government to ensure the availability of appropriate personal protective equipment for all doctors, nurses and other health workers actively attending to Covid patients.
A Bench headed by Justice Ashok Bhushan also ordered the Centre, states/UTs and respective police authorities to provide the necessary police security to the doctors and medical staff engaged in treating Covid patients.
“The state shall take action against those who obstruct and commit any offence in respect to performance of duties by doctors, medical staff and other government officials deputed to contain Covid,” said the Bench which also included Justice S Ravindra Bhat.— TNS
